Regarding the passenger seat, to allow someone into the back seat, push the seat back lever DOWN. This will flip the back of the seat forward and allow the seat to slide forward. Simply push firmly on the seat back (no need to touch the lever) and it will return to its original position.
If you pull the seat back lever UP, you can adjust the recline angle of the seat back. Pulling the lever UP will also let you fold the seat and slide it forward, however, it will not return to its original position.
If you can hear a faint click sound as the steering wheel is returned to the centered position, then my solution may apply. This type of problem was found on a 1997 Dodge Neon. There are two issues on this car. There are a pair of reset tabs that rotate with the steering column. They can move out of position because they are part of an assembly that latches into position. When the assembly is snapped back into position this may resolve the problem. In my case it allowed the turn signal to reset in one direction. Next, I cut a short
0.3" section of 0.25" I.D. aluminum tubing and notched and shaped it to fit over the cam on the end of the reset lever on the turn signal assembly. I crimped it so the piece could not fall off. This made the reset lever cam slightly wider and allowed it to be pushed a little further by the reset tabs. This has worked very well.
